[Risolto] [NVidia] Probl installazione driver nvidia .run 96.43.1x , scheda GeForce4 MX 440 | Lucid

Riconoscimento, installazione e configurazione delle periferiche.
Scrivi risposta
Avatar utente
reza
Prode Principiante
Messaggi: 204
Iscrizione: sabato 27 settembre 2008, 21:30

[Risolto] [NVidia] Probl installazione driver nvidia .run 96.43.1x , scheda GeForce4 MX 440 | Lucid

Messaggio da reza »

Salve a tutti.
Ho appena effettuato un'installazione minimale di Ubuntu 10.04 LTS tramite cd alternate, usando l'opzione "Installa un sistema a riga di comando".
Come ho sempre fatto con le versioni precedenti, una volta installato il sistema base ed effettuato il login, ho dato:

Codice: Seleziona tutto

sudo apt-get install xorg openbox binutils gcc
A questo punto, dopo aver riavviato, ho tentato di installare il driver .run per la mia scheda video GeForce4 MX 440, ho provato sia il 96.43.17 (current prerelease) che il 96.43.16 (current official release).

Ho digitato:

Codice: Seleziona tutto

sudo sh NVIDIA-Linux-x86-96.43.17-pkg1.run

Purtroppo durante la fase "building kernel module mi ha sputato in faccia questo errore:
ERROR: Unable to load the kernel module 'nvidia.ko'.  This happens most
      frequently when this kernel module was built against the wrong or
      improperly configured kernel sources, with a version of gcc that differs
      from the one used to build the target kernel, or if a driver such as
      rivafb/nvidiafb is present and prevents the NVIDIA kernel module from
      obtaining ownership of the NVIDIA graphics device(s).
     
      Please see the log entries 'Kernel module load error' and 'Kernel
      messages' at the end of the file '/var/log/nvidia-installer.log' for
      more information.

ERROR: Installation has failed.  Please see the file
      '/var/log/nvidia-installer.log' for details.  You may find suggestions
      on fixing installation problems in the README available on the Linux
      driver download page at www.nvidia.com.
Vi chiedo aiuto su come procedere.

In allegato il file nvidia-installer.log

Altre info utili:

Codice: Seleziona tutto

Linux version 2.6.32-21-generic (buildd@rothera) (gcc version 4.4.3 (Ubuntu 4.4.3-4ubuntu5) ) #32-Ubuntu SMP Fri Apr 16 08:10:02 UTC 2010
Grazie per eventuali risposte   (yes) e buon Lucid Lynx a tutti  (good)
Allegati
nvidia-installer.log
(52.89 KiB) Scaricato 31 volte
Ultima modifica di Anonymous il lunedì 3 maggio 2010, 13:24, modificato 1 volta in totale.
Avatar utente
gargantua
Entusiasta Emergente
Entusiasta Emergente
Messaggi: 1770
Iscrizione: venerdì 2 giugno 2006, 16:01
Desktop: Ubuntu 12.10 Gnome Shell
Distribuzione: Ubuntu 12.10 i686
Località: Pordenone
Contatti:

Re: [NVidia] Aiuto installazione driver nvidia .run 96.43.1x , scheda GeForce4 MX 440 | Lucid

Messaggio da gargantua »

I driver nvidia .run vanno installati da terminale virtuale tty1 a cui si accede con CTRL+ALT+F1 .
Usando gnome bisogna stoppare prima anche gdm con il comando

Codice: Seleziona tutto

sudo stop gdm
con openbox non so  :)
Cordoglio anche nelle fabbriche cinesi Apple: gli operai hanno osservato un secondo di raccoglimento.  ///   Dopo la diagnosi, sette anni per spegnersi. Per una volta è stato lui a copiare Windows.
Avatar utente
reza
Prode Principiante
Messaggi: 204
Iscrizione: sabato 27 settembre 2008, 21:30

Re: [NVidia] Aiuto installazione driver nvidia .run 96.43.1x , scheda GeForce4 MX 440 | Lucid

Messaggio da reza »

gargantua ha scritto: I driver nvidia .run vanno installati da terminale virtuale tty1 a cui si accede con CTRL+ALT+F1 .
Usando gnome bisogna stoppare prima anche gdm con il comando

Codice: Seleziona tutto

sudo stop gdm
con openbox non so  :)

Si lo so, comunque penso che né openbox né il login manager (il problema lo dava anche quando non avevo installato slim) c'entrino nulla.

1) Alla fine sono riuscito ad installare i driver tramite jockey-gtk (installato con il comando sudo apt-get install jockey-gtk, si ha portato dietro una marea di dipendenze).
2) Ho provato a disinstallare i driver da jockey-gtk (in seguito ho disinstallato anche jockey-gtk) ed ho reinstallato i driver .run, morale della favola: questa volta li ha installati.

3) Ora sto formattando e reinstallando Lucid, voglio assolutamente installare i driver tramite .run e vorrei capire il perchè di quel messaggio di errore. Forse era dovuto ad un file .run corrotto o magari alla mancanza di qualche dipendenza (che dopo aver installato jockey-gtk si è risolta) oppure ad un riavvio necessario ma non eseguito!

Vi farò sapere.

Grazie comunque per la tua risposta.

Saluti  :)
Avatar utente
reza
Prode Principiante
Messaggi: 204
Iscrizione: sabato 27 settembre 2008, 21:30

[Risolto] Re: [NVidia] Aiuto installazione driver nvidia .run 96.43.1x , scheda GeForce4 MX 440 | Lu

Messaggio da reza »

Ho reinstallato Lucid alternate, installato xorg, riavviato, provato ad installare i driver nvidia da .run e dava lo stesso errore di prima.

Allora ho dato:

Codice: Seleziona tutto

sudo lsmod
ed ho notato il modulo nouveau.

Pensando ad un qualche tipo di conflitto ho deciso di metterlo in blacklist editando il file /etc/modprobe.d/blacklist.conf con:

Codice: Seleziona tutto

sudo nano /etc/modprobe.d/blacklist.conf
Alla fine del file ho aggiunto una riga personalizzata

Codice: Seleziona tutto

# custom
blacklist nouveau
Ho salvato e riavviato. Come per magia al seguente riavvio sono riuscito ad installare il driver nvidia .run 96.43.17.
Quindi è certo che sto modulo nouveau dava problemi ed impediva di installare il driver proprietario nvidia .run.

Risolto penso.

Saluti.
Avatar utente
reza
Prode Principiante
Messaggi: 204
Iscrizione: sabato 27 settembre 2008, 21:30

Re: [NVidia] Probl installazione driver nvidia .run 96.43.1x , scheda GeForce4 MX 440 | Lucid

Messaggio da reza »

Nonostante sia riuscito ad installare i driver .run purtroppo funzionano malissimo. A volte il sistema va in crash e mi porta ad una schermata nera con dei caratteri indecifrabili, oppure crash con schermata a mille colori. Le tty funzionano 1 volta si e 10 NO, le volte che non funzionano, anch'esse mi fanno andare in crash il sistema: si sdoppia e sovrappone lo schermo, schermate nere, schermo morto o schermate a mille colori.

Ora provo ad installare i driver tramite jockey-gtk.
La vedo dura...  >:(

Edit:
Installati i driver con jockey-gtk, stessi problemi.

Edit2:
Il mio xorg.conf

Codice: Seleziona tutto

# nvidia-xconfig: X configuration file generated by nvidia-xconfig
# nvidia-xconfig:  version 1.0  (buildmeister@builder63)  Thu Jan 28 16:14:36 PST 2010

Section "ServerLayout"
    Identifier     "Layout0"
    Screen      0  "Screen0"
    InputDevice    "Keyboard0" "CoreKeyboard"
    InputDevice    "Mouse0" "CorePointer"
EndSection

Section "Files"
EndSection

Section "InputDevice"
    # generated from default
    Identifier     "Mouse0"
    Driver         "mouse"
    Option         "Protocol" "auto"
    Option         "Device" "/dev/psaux"
    Option         "Emulate3Buttons" "no"
    Option         "ZAxisMapping" "4 5"
EndSection

Section "InputDevice"
    # generated from default
    Identifier     "Keyboard0"
    Driver         "kbd"
EndSection

Section "Monitor"
    Identifier     "Monitor0"
    VendorName     "Unknown"
    ModelName      "Unknown"
    HorizSync       30.0 - 110.0
    VertRefresh     50.0 - 150.0
    Option         "DPMS"
EndSection

Section "Device"
    Identifier     "Device0"
    Driver         "nvidia"
    VendorName     "NVIDIA Corporation"
EndSection

Section "Screen"
    Identifier     "Screen0"
    Device         "Device0"
    Monitor        "Monitor0"
    DefaultDepth    24
    SubSection     "Display"
        Depth       24
        Modes      "1600x1200" "1280x1024" "1024x768" "800x600" "640x480"
    EndSubSection
EndSection
Ultima modifica di Anonymous il sabato 1 maggio 2010, 21:52, modificato 1 volta in totale.
Avatar utente
reza
Prode Principiante
Messaggi: 204
Iscrizione: sabato 27 settembre 2008, 21:30

Re: [NVidia] Probl installazione driver nvidia .run 96.43.1x , scheda GeForce4 MX 440 | Lucid

Messaggio da reza »

reza ha scritto: Nonostante sia riuscito ad installare i driver .run purtroppo funzionano malissimo. A volte il sistema va in crash e mi porta ad una schermata nera con dei caratteri indecifrabili, oppure crash con schermata a mille colori. Le tty funzionano 1 volta si e 10, le volte che non funzionano anch'esse mi fanno andare in crash il sistema, si sdoppia e sovrappone lo schermo, schermate nere, schermo morto o schermate a mille colori.

Ora provo ad installare i driver tramite jockey-gtk.
La vedo dura...  >:(

Edit:
Installati i driver con jockey-gtk, stessi problemi.

Diciamo che ho risolto quasi tutti i suddetti problemi aggiungendo questi moduli al file blacklist.conf

Codice: Seleziona tutto

# custom
blacklist nouveau
blacklist lbm-nouveau
blacklist nvidia-current
blacklist nvidia-173
blacklist vgastate
blacklist vga16fb
blacklist joydev
blacklist emu10k1_gp
blacklist gameport
blacklist sis_agp
blacklist serio_raw
Ho anche abilitato l'Agp FastWrites creando un file chiamato nvidia nella cartella /etc/modprobe.d, all'interno c'ho copiato queste righe:

Codice: Seleziona tutto

alias char-major-195* nvidia
options nvidia NVreg_EnableAGPSBA=1 NVreg_EnableAGPFW=1
Ora funziona tutto, ogni tanto va in crash (schermo rosso a righe, rosso per via del mio sfondo) mentre navigo tra le tty e qualche volta si risveglia dalla sospensione con una bella schermata a righe blu.. (in questo caso, facendo ctrl+alt+canc inizia la procedura di riavvio ed effettivamente si riavvia).
Attualmente uso i driver 96.43.17 installati tramite file .run.

Mah!

Dato che le mia cultura è abbastanza limitata, gradirei comunque avere qualche feedback da parte vostra. Vorrei capire se la fonte di tutto sto casino è il driver nvidia oppure se la situazione è causata dal fatto che Lucid possa avere qualche componente aggiornato che fa a botte con i driver proprietari (che su karmic andavano alla grande). Certamente i moduli nouveau e sis_agp c'entrano qualcosa.

Salutissimi  (b2b)
Ultima modifica di Anonymous il sabato 1 maggio 2010, 21:59, modificato 1 volta in totale.
Avatar utente
gargantua
Entusiasta Emergente
Entusiasta Emergente
Messaggi: 1770
Iscrizione: venerdì 2 giugno 2006, 16:01
Desktop: Ubuntu 12.10 Gnome Shell
Distribuzione: Ubuntu 12.10 i686
Località: Pordenone
Contatti:

Re: [NVidia] Probl installazione driver nvidia .run 96.43.1x , scheda GeForce4 MX 440 | Lucid

Messaggio da gargantua »

Uso Lucid da più di tre mesi e mi è capitato due volte di dover installare i driver nvidia .run
(jokey per un lungo periodo non funzionava proprio) ma la procedura è sempre andata a buon fine e senza i fastidiosi bug che lamenti, per l'installazione ho usato questa procedura http://forum.ubuntu-it.org/viewtopic.php?p=2088568#p2088568.
Bisogna dire che ho una nvidia 8800GT e quindi driver diversi da quelli installati da te, giusto per dire che come feedback vale poco  :)
Peccato non esista più il supporto per envy http://albertomilone.com/nvidia_scripts1.html su Lucid, quel programma lanciato da console in recovery mode mi ha salvato il c**o parecchie volte quando la compilazione dei binari nvidia falliva.......
Cordoglio anche nelle fabbriche cinesi Apple: gli operai hanno osservato un secondo di raccoglimento.  ///   Dopo la diagnosi, sette anni per spegnersi. Per una volta è stato lui a copiare Windows.
Avatar utente
reza
Prode Principiante
Messaggi: 204
Iscrizione: sabato 27 settembre 2008, 21:30

Re: [NVidia] Probl installazione driver nvidia .run 96.43.1x , scheda GeForce4 MX 440 | Lucid

Messaggio da reza »

gargantua ha scritto: Uso Lucid da più di tre mesi e mi è capitato due volte di dover installare i driver nvidia .run
(jokey per un lungo periodo non funzionava proprio) ma la procedura è sempre andata a buon fine e senza i fastidiosi bug che lamenti, per l'installazione ho usato questa procedura http://forum.ubuntu-it.org/viewtopic.php?p=2088568#p2088568.
Bisogna dire che ho una nvidia 8800GT e quindi driver diversi da quelli installati da te, giusto per dire che come feedback vale poco  :)
Peccato non esista più il supporto per envy http://albertomilone.com/nvidia_scripts1.html su Lucid, quel programma lanciato da console in recovery mode mi ha salvato il c**o parecchie volte quando la compilazione dei binari nvidia falliva.......
Ti ringrazio, proverò ad installare i driver con la procedura di quel link, anche se certi passi dovrò saltarti, dato che non uso i linux-restricted-modules e nemmeno gdm.

I problemi persistono, purtroppo mettendo in blacklist tutte quelle cose non è servito niente.
Intanto ho provato a disinstallare slim, ora per accedere faccio login testuale e do startx, vado per esclusione.
Pocanzi è successa una cosa stranissima, la videata (il desktop con tutte le finestre etc.) ha iniziato a spostarsi lateralmente, uscendo fuori dai bordi del monitor, ogni volta che che premevo il tasto INVIO si muoveva di qualche centimetro verso sinistra, alla fine a forza di premere INVIO è ritornata nella posizione originale, allucinante direi  (rotfl).

Ogni altro consiglio è  ben accetto!!  :(
Avatar utente
gargantua
Entusiasta Emergente
Entusiasta Emergente
Messaggi: 1770
Iscrizione: venerdì 2 giugno 2006, 16:01
Desktop: Ubuntu 12.10 Gnome Shell
Distribuzione: Ubuntu 12.10 i686
Località: Pordenone
Contatti:

Re: [NVidia] Probl installazione driver nvidia .run 96.43.1x , scheda GeForce4 MX 440 | Lucid

Messaggio da gargantua »

reza ha scritto: ..........ogni volta che che premevo il tasto INVIO si muoveva di qualche centimetro verso sinistra, alla fine a forza di premere INVIO è ritornata nella posizione originale, allucinante direi  (rotfl).
E meno male che aveva un effetto circolare, se andava in linea retta eri ancora li ad inseguire la schermata  (rotfl)
Cordoglio anche nelle fabbriche cinesi Apple: gli operai hanno osservato un secondo di raccoglimento.  ///   Dopo la diagnosi, sette anni per spegnersi. Per una volta è stato lui a copiare Windows.
Avatar utente
reza
Prode Principiante
Messaggi: 204
Iscrizione: sabato 27 settembre 2008, 21:30

Re: [NVidia] Probl installazione driver nvidia .run 96.43.1x , scheda GeForce4 MX 440 | Lucid

Messaggio da reza »

gargantua ha scritto:
reza ha scritto: ..........ogni volta che che premevo il tasto INVIO si muoveva di qualche centimetro verso sinistra, alla fine a forza di premere INVIO è ritornata nella posizione originale, allucinante direi  (rotfl).
E meno male che aveva un effetto circolare, se andava in linea retta eri ancora li ad inseguire la schermata  (rotfl)

(rotfl)

Dopo 1 giorno di prove intensive, sembra proprio che molti dei problemi fossero causati da slim login manager (installato dai repo di Ubuntu). Disinstallato slim non ho avuto per ora problemi di sdoppiamento schermo, crash con schermate a mille colori, mancati risvegli dalla sospensione, crash mentre si naviga tra le tty.

Per sicurezza ho lasciato in blacklist.conf i seguenti moduli:

Codice: Seleziona tutto

# custom
blacklist nouveau
blacklist lbm-nouveau
blacklist nvidia-current
blacklist nvidia-173
blacklist vgastate
blacklist vga16fb
blacklist joydev
blacklist emu10k1_gp
blacklist gameport
blacklist sis_agp
blacklist serio_raw
blacklist nv
blacklist nvidia_new
È certo che, a prescindere da slim* login manager, il modulo nouveau mi impediva di installare i driver nvidia .run, mentre sis_agp impediva la sospensione/ibernazione e l'attivazione dell'agp fastwrites, per quanto riguarda vgastate e vga16fb, interferivano a livello di sfarfallio multi-colore sulla parte alta dello schermo.

Per ora mi arrangio facendo il login testuale + startx, in attesa di trovare un'alternativa che non sia gdm, kdm o xdm. Vorrei qualcosa che permettesse l'autologin. Tempo fa mi arrangiavo con un file chiamato .bash_profile, ma ho perso parte della configurazione.

Grazie.  (b2b)


*****************************************************************************************************

Edit1:
Per quanto riguarda l'autologin in assenza di un login manager, ho risolto modificando il file /etc/rc.local  aggiungendo la riga: su - tuousername -c startx    prima della riga exit 0

Codice: Seleziona tutto

#!/bin/sh -e
#
# rc.local
#
# This script is executed at the end of each multiuser runlevel.
# Make sure that the script will "exit 0" on success or any other
# value on error.
#
# In order to enable or disable this script just change the execution
# bits.
#
# By default this script does nothing.
su - tuousername -c startx
exit 0
per far funzionare l'autologin a questo punto ho creato il file .bash_profile da mettere nella home, questo è presente questo codice:

Codice: Seleziona tutto

if [ -z "$DISPLAY" ] && [ $(tty) == /dev/tty1 ]; then
while [ 1 == 1 ]
        do
                startx
                sleep 0
        done
fi
Quindi niente gdm, xdm, kdm, slim e per ora nessun problema grafico o crash.

*****************************************************************************************************







*****************************************************************************************************

Edit2:
*
Slim deve aver un bug, poichè mi ha causato gli stessi problemi installandolo su un altro pc con hardware completamente diverso.

*****************************************************************************************************
Ultima modifica di Anonymous il domenica 6 giugno 2010, 4:12, modificato 1 volta in totale.
Scrivi risposta

Ritorna a “Driver e periferiche”

Chi c’è in linea

Visualizzano questa sezione: criceto45, tropie e 6 ospiti